PDF转换服务
我需要开发一项能够将 MS Office 和 Open Office 文档转换为 PDF 的服务。并且 PDF 在 ADOBE Reader 中打开时还需要可注释。
我使用了 www.neevia.com 上的一个软件。它可以进行转换,但无法使 PDF 具有可注释性,因此在我的场景中毫无用处。
理想情况下,我想要一个监视目录的软件,当文件提交到该目录时,该软件会检测到这一点,获取文件,转换它,然后将其放入另一个目录中。这样我就可以以编程方式将要转换的文件放入 IN 文件夹中,并监视 OUT 文件夹以在转换时获取文件。
那么有人知道一款能够将 MS Office 和 Open Office 文件转换为可注释 PDF 的软件吗?
I need to develop a service able to convert MS Office and Open Office documents to PDF. And the PDF`s also need to be commentable when opened in ADOBE Reader.
I have used a piece of software from www.neevia.com. And it does the conversion, but is not able to make the PDF´s commentable and is therefore useless in my scenario.
Ideally I would like a piece of software that is monitoring a directory, and when a file is commited to that directory, the software detects this, fetches the file, converts it, and puts it in another directory. This way I can programmatically put the file I want converted in the IN folder and monitor the OUT folder to fetch the file when converted.
So do anyone know a piece of software capable of converting MS Office and Open Office files to commentable PDF`s?
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(6)
听起来您似乎正在追求 Acrobat Professional 的“扩展 Acrobat Reader 中的功能”文档权限功能。如果您想要一种编程方式来做到这一点,那么 Adobe LiveCycle 是唯一的游戏。这是 Adobe 为自己保留的功能之一,法律不允许任何第三方提供该功能。
It sounds like you're after the "Extend Features In Acrobat Reader" document rights feature that's part of Acrobat Professional. If you want a programmatic way of doing it then Adobe LiveCycle is the only game in town. This is one of the features that Adobe keeps for itself and no third party is legally allowed to provide it.
您可以使用办公自动化以编程方式将文档打印到 postscript 打印机驱动程序以获取 postscript 文件,然后使用 GhostScript 将 PS 文件转换为 PDF。不确定 Adobe Reader 相对于完整版本的 Acrobat 支持的可评论功能,但它应该创建一个相当良好支持的 PDF 文件。
You could programmatically, using office automation, print documents to a postscript printer driver to get a postscript file, then use GhostScript to convert the PS file to PDF. Not sure of the commentable features supported by Adobe Reader as opposed to the full version of Acrobat, but it should create a reasonably well supported PDF file.
A-PDF 可以做你想做的事,它是网站声称它可以将 Office 文档转换为 PDF,包括通过查看文件夹进行批量转换。
A-PDF may do what you want, it's web site claims it can convert office docs into PDF including batch convertion with watching a folder.
Office 2007 和 OpenOffice 都可以直接保存为 PDF,因此您可以自动化该过程。
然而,更改 PDF 的“文档权限”以允许评论是只有 Adobe Acrobat 可以做到的事情。 (这是 Adobe 销售更多产品的方式)。还有其他第三方工具声称能够做到这一点(谷歌更改 pdf +“文档权利”),但我不能保证其中任何一个。
Both Office 2007 and OpenOffice can save directly to PDF, so you could automate that process.
However, changing the "document rights" of the PDF to allow commenting is something that only Adobe Acrobat can do. (This is Adobe's way of selling more product). There are other 3rd-party tools out there that claim to be able to do it (google change pdf +"document rights"), but I can't vouch for any of them.
我相信可评论功能是 PDF 软件的一部分,而不是文件的一部分。 Adobe Professional 将允许添加注释,而读者的功能较少。
I believe the commentable features are part of the PDF software, and not the file. Adobe Professional will allow to add comments, while the reader has less capabilities.
嗯,您可以自己开发或直接购买现成的。我的公司(无耻插件)有一个产品,可以对常见的 Office 格式进行基于服务器的 PDF 转换,并且可以通过 Web 服务调用。
在此处撰写博客。至少可以说,在服务器(32 位/64 位、Win2K3/Win2K8)上可靠地进行办公是一项挑战。
Hmmm, you can develop your own or just buy it off the shelf. My company (shameless plug) has a product that does server based PDF Conversion for common Office formats and can be invoked via a web service.
Blogged about it here. Making office work reliably on the server (32bit/64bit, Win2K3/Win2K8) is challenging to say the least.